What do you get when you combine 100 fifth graders with 100 lab coats? The Learn By Doing Lab (SCM 302) is a great way to help get kids excited about science while you gain teaching experience. And you don't even have to leave campus! Several sections of SCM 302 are offered every Winter and Spring Quarter. Once a week about 100 elementary or middle school kids visit Cal Poly and do hands-on science with Cal Poly students as the instructors. Students registered in SCM 302 get to decide how to organize and teach the activities.
SCM 302 is a 2-unit, Pass/No Pass class. Many Biology students use SCM 302 as an advisor approved elective.
